Did anyone catch 'Walking the Nile' (it is still on 4OD) back in January?

Levison Wood attempts to walk the length of the Nile with local guides to help.

On a stretch through a Ugandan 'grassy plain'- in land from the Nile because of a 5 mile crocodile infested swamp that surrounds it at that point- Levison is joined by a UK travel writer and a US travel photographer (all ex military) for a few days. 4 hours into the walk across the plain in 40 odd degree heat the photographer starts to be affected by heat stroke. They rig up a shade, cool him with water, call in emergency evacuation (4 hours away), but within 2 hours he is dead... aged 40 with a wife and two children back in the US.

Truly shocking. I was so numb watching and trying to understand how a fit man can die so quickly of heat stroke.

It was a great series (4 programmes) but the first episode was a wake up call for those in search of adventure.
